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of robotic arm technology, specifically a multi-joint robotic arm. Background Technology

[0002] Articulated robots, also known as articulated robotic arms or multi-joint robots, have joints that move in rotation, similar to a human arm. Articulated robots are one of the most common forms of industrial robots in the industrial field today, suitable for mechanical automation operations in many industrial fields, such as automatic assembly, painting, handling, and welding. They can be classified in different ways according to their structure.

[0003] Patent CN219543185U discloses a multi-joint robotic arm, including a base and a robotic arm rotatably mounted on top of the base. A movable frame is slidably mounted on the left side of the base, and a counterweight is mounted on the inner side of the movable frame. Support plates are fixed on the front and rear surfaces of the movable frame, and support sleeves are fixed on the front and rear surfaces of the base. This utility model improves and optimizes existing multi-joint robotic arms by designing a counterweight that can move laterally left and right on the left side of the base. This allows the operator to adjust the horizontal position of the counterweight according to the actual weight of the object to be gripped by the robotic arm. When gripping a heavier object, simply slide the movable frame and the counterweight to the left without adding a new counterweight. The overall stability of the robotic arm in gripping the object on the right side of the base is maintained by lever principles, preventing the robotic arm from tilting to the right. This reduces operating costs while ensuring stability.

[0004] The above-mentioned device has certain shortcomings in its use: Since the length of the robotic arm in the device is fixed, items within the maximum extension length of the robotic arm can be clamped, but when the item exceeds this distance, it needs to be moved. The length cannot be adjusted each time the robotic arm is operated, which makes it inconvenient to use.

[0005] Therefore, this utility model provides a multi-joint robotic arm to solve the above problems. Utility Model Content

[0006] To address the shortcomings of existing technologies, this invention provides a multi-joint robotic arm that solves the aforementioned problems.

[0007] To achieve the above objectives, this utility model is implemented through the following technical solution: a multi-joint robotic arm, including a base plate, a counterweight assembly installed on the top wall of the base plate, a lifting assembly fixedly installed on the top wall of the counterweight assembly, and an adjustment assembly installed on the right side wall of the lifting assembly;

[0008] The adjustment assembly includes a first robotic arm, a second robotic arm, and a third robotic arm, which are uniformly arranged linearly. A rotating seat is fixedly installed on the left side wall of each of the first, second, and third robotic arms. A U-shaped frame is rotatably mounted on the outer wall of each of the rotating seats via a rotating shaft. A connecting plate I is fixedly installed on the left side wall of each of the U-shaped frames, and a connecting plate II is fixedly installed on the left side wall of each connecting plate I. Limiting grooves are formed on the front and rear inner walls of each of the first, second, and third robotic arms. Through openings are formed on the right side walls of each of the first, second, and third robotic arms. Hydraulic rods are fixedly installed on the inner walls of each of the first, second, and third robotic arms. Cross blocks are fixedly installed on the movable ends of each of the hydraulic rods. Movable columns are fixedly installed on the right side walls of each of the cross blocks. Drive motors are fixedly installed on the front walls of each of the U-shaped frames. A mechanical claw is fixedly installed on the right end of the rightmost movable column.

[0009] Through the above technical solution, the adjustment component can adjust the overall working range of the first robotic arm, the second robotic arm and the third robotic arm, and has good adjustment adaptability.

[0010] Furthermore, the connecting plate two located on the far left is fixedly connected to the right side wall of the lifting assembly, the outer walls of several cross blocks are slidably connected to the inner walls of the corresponding limiting grooves, the outer walls of several movable columns are slidably connected to the inner walls of the corresponding through holes, the right ends of several movable columns are fixedly connected to the corresponding connecting plate two, and the power shaft of the drive motor passes through the corresponding U-shaped frame and is fixedly connected to the corresponding rotating shaft via a bearing.

[0011] With the above technical solution, the cross block slides in the inner wall of the corresponding limiting groove to prevent deviation during movement.

[0012] Furthermore, the lifting assembly includes a C-shaped frame, the bottom end of which is fixedly connected to the top wall of the counterweight assembly. An electric slide rail is installed on the inner wall of the C-shaped frame, and an electric slider is slidably installed on the outer wall of the electric slide rail. The right side wall of the electric slider is fixedly connected to the corresponding connecting plate.

[0013] Through the above technical solution, the working height of the first robotic arm, the second robotic arm, and the third robotic arm can be adjusted by the cooperation of the electric slide rail and the electric slider.

[0014] Furthermore, the counterweight assembly includes a base, the bottom wall of which is fixedly connected to the top wall of the base plate.

[0015] Through the above technical solution, the base has functions such as counterweight.

[0016] Furthermore, an electric turntable is fixedly installed on the top wall of the base, and a mounting base is fixedly installed on the top wall of the electric turntable. The top wall of the mounting base is fixedly connected to the bottom wall of the C-shaped frame.

[0017] Through the above technical solution, the electric turntable can drive the mounting base and C-shaped frame to rotate, which in turn drives the electric slide rail, electric slider, and the first, second, and third robotic arms to rotate, enabling the picking and placing of materials in different directions.

[0018] Furthermore, each of the outer walls of the base is fixedly equipped with a load-bearing frame, and each of the two load-bearing frames is slidably equipped with a counterweight.

[0019] Through the above technical solution, the center of gravity of the entire device can be adjusted by the cooperation of the counterweight and the load-bearing frame.

[0020] Furthermore, fastening bolts are screwed onto the four corners of the top wall of the substrate.

[0021] Through the above technical solution, the entire device can be fixed by the cooperation of the fastening bolts on the substrate.

[0039] During operation, the device is installed in its working position using the base plate 1 and fastening bolts 2. An external power supply and controller are electrically connected to the electric turntable 35, electric slide rail 42, electric slider 43, drive motor 53, hydraulic rod 57, and mechanical gripper 512. When using the entire device, the hydraulic rod 57 pushes the corresponding cross block 58 to slide within the corresponding limiting groove 56. Simultaneously, the cross block 58 drives the movable column 59 to extend outward from the corresponding through-hole 55, thereby moving the corresponding connecting plate 1 511 and connecting plate 2 510. This causes the first robotic arm 54, the second robotic arm 513, and the third robotic arm 514 to extend outward, further expanding their working range. Simultaneously, when it is necessary to adjust the working angle of the first robotic arm 54, the second robotic arm 513, and the third robotic arm 514, the corresponding drive motor 53 is activated to rotate the shaft and the corresponding rotating seat 52, thus allowing for rapid adjustment of the first robotic arm 54's working angle. The extension positions of robotic arm 54, second robotic arm 513, and third robotic arm 514 can drive the robotic claw 512 to move and grasp various items. Through the cooperation of electric slide rail 42 and electric slider 43, the height of the corresponding connecting plate 2 510 and connecting plate 1 511 can be adjusted, thereby driving the height of the entire first robotic arm 54, second robotic arm 513, and third robotic arm 514 to match the height of different items, making it more convenient to work. The counterweight 33 slides on the outer wall of the corresponding load-bearing frame 32, allowing the counterweight of the entire device to be adjusted to improve working safety. The electric turntable 35 drives the mounting base 34 to rotate, which in turn drives the C-shaped frame 41, electric slide rail 42, and electric slider 43 to rotate, ultimately driving the first robotic arm 54, second robotic arm 513, and third robotic arm 514 to rotate, enabling the grasping of items in different directions, making it more convenient to use.
